The good news is that there are many options and opportunities for continuing your education.Master’s degree vs. masters degree. The correct spelling is master’s degree, with an apostrophe. The term master’s degree is possessive; the degree belongs to a master. When talking about a specific degree, use capitals and format it as “Master of . . .” as in, “a Master of Science degree.”. The knowledge and skills you gain from a master's program may be transferable across ...Mar 31, 2021 · Here’s the high-level breakdown: The Master of Arts in Teaching is a master’s-level degree that focuses on the art and science of teaching. It’s a degree for teachers who want to improve in the craft of teaching itself but who generally want to remain in the classroom. Our programme will provide you ...A graduate degree or master’s degree is an advanced degree that some students pursue after earning a bachelor’s degree. Earning a graduate degree signifies mastery of a particular field of study and focuses more intensely on a subject than a bachelor’s degree does. Graduate degrees usually take two years to attain. Careers with a master’s in teaching or a master’s in educationMany master’s education programs fall within 25 to 45 total credit hours. Full-time students will typically take about two years to complete a program, while part-time students can take from three to four years. Some universities offer online master’s degree programs that can be completed in as few as 12 to 18 months.
